Output 0653dbfa9b40635038ad9cf26cbf2ad90bbeb1c277ea4d4bf66dc97bbec9900a:1

value
1051997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63f9f87fd7e48ea20c98ad8ceb7ac7c35c51fc2 OP_EQUAL
address
3Q94NMDJyYzctQ73iGtHz1SbRyVz6pRLss
transaction
0653dbfa9b40635038ad9cf26cbf2ad90bbeb1c277ea4d4bf66dc97bbec9900a
confirmations
323373
spent
true